Former Australian fast bowler Jason Gillespie has expressed concern about the mindset of modern-day batters, suggesting that many lack the mental strength needed to succeed in tough conditions. He believes that instead of fighting through difficult spells, several players tend to surrender their wickets too easily. Gillespie pointed out that Test cricket has always demanded patience, discipline, and the ability to absorb pressure, qualities that seem to be fading in the current era.

With aggressive batting becoming the norm, he feels the traditional virtues of building an innings and respecting challenging bowling are being overlooked. His comments underline a broader issue in contemporary cricket, where entertainment and quick scoring often take priority over technique and temperament.

Training Methods Under The Scanner

Jason Gillespie also questioned the quality and intensity of batting practice, hinting that modern training environments may not be demanding enough. He stressed that true improvement comes only when players are pushed outside their comfort zones. Facing high-quality bowling on difficult surfaces during practice helps batters develop problem-solving skills and confidence under pressure.

According to Gillespie, if training conditions are too easy, players fail to prepare themselves for real match challenges. He suggested that batters should be willing to struggle in practice, as those experiences play a crucial role in building resilience and adaptability. Without such preparation, players may find themselves exposed when conditions turn hostile during competitive games.

Importance Of Old-School Test Cricket Values

Reflecting on recent performances in international cricket, Gillespie observed that batters from both sides have found it hard to cope when conditions favour bowlers. He noted that instead of digging in and adjusting their game, some players have lost patience and played risky shots at the wrong moments.

Gillespie emphasised that Test cricket still rewards those who show determination, strong defence, and smart decision-making. While the format has evolved and scoring rates have increased, the fundamentals of success remain unchanged. His comments serve as a reminder that embracing classic Test match values is essential for batters who want to thrive at the highest level, regardless of how the modern game continues to evolve.
